Walkway pressure washing involves using high-pressure water to thoroughly clean outdoor surfaces such as concrete, brick, or stone walkways. This service effectively removes dirt, grime, algae, moss, and stains that can accumulate over time, especially in areas with frequent foot traffic or exposure to the elements. By applying targeted pressure and, if needed, specialized cleaning solutions, service providers can restore the appearance of walkways, making them look cleaner and more inviting. This process not only enhances curb appeal but also helps maintain the integrity of the surface by removing substances that can cause deterioration if left untreated.
Many common problems can be addressed with walkway pressure washing. Over time, walkways can become slippery due to algae or moss buildup, creating safety hazards for residents and visitors. Stains from oil, rust, or organic matter may also develop, detracting from the property's overall appearance. Additionally, dirt and debris can obscure the natural beauty of the paving materials, making outdoor spaces look neglected. Pressure washing is an effective solution for resolving these issues, helping to improve safety, prevent long-term damage, and refresh the look of outdoor walkways.

The overview below groups typical Walkway Pressure Washing proj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Winchester, VA.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Pressure Washing Jobs - Typical costs for routine walkway cleaning in Winchester range from $250 to $600. Many common projects fall within this range, covering sidewalks, small patios, and entryways. Larger or more complex jobs may cost more depending on size and condition.
Medium-Size Projects - For larger walkways or multiple areas, local contractors often charge between $600 and $1,200. These projects are common for homeowners seeking comprehensive cleaning of multiple surfaces or larger patios.
Heavy-Duty Cleaning - Deep cleaning or restoration work on heavily stained or moss-covered walkways can range from $1,200 to $2,500. Such jobs are less frequent but are necessary for extensive buildup or surface repairs.
Full Replacement or Major Repairs - When walkway surfaces need replacement or significant repairs, costs can exceed $5,000. These projects are less common and typically involve extensive work beyond pressure washing alone.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What surfaces can walkways be pressure washed? Local contractors typically pressure wash concrete, stone, brick, and pavers on walkways to remove dirt, grime, and stains effectively.
Is pressure washing safe for all walkway materials? Most walkway materials are suitable for pressure washing, but it's best to have a professional assess the surface to prevent damage.
How often should walkways be pressure washed? Regular cleaning every 1-2 years is common, depending on foot traffic and environmental conditions in Winchester, VA.
Can pressure washing remove stubborn stains from walkways? Yes, experienced service providers can often eliminate stains like oil, rust, or algae with appropriate techniques.
What should be done before pressure washing a walkway? It’s recommended to clear the walkway of debris and inform the service provider of any specific stains or concerns for proper treatment.
